Hood ornaments slowly disappeared as cars became safer, sleeker, cheaper to build, and less welcoming to pointy pieces of metal.
Hood Ornaments Originally Had a PurposeSome of the earliest hood ornaments weren’t purely decorative.
Exterior-projection regulations didn’t simply ban hood ornaments, but they required protruding ornaments to retract, detach, or bend when force was applied.
But hood ornaments now appear mostly on expensive luxury cars, where an elaborate badge can be treated as part of the theater.
Hood Ornaments Were Replaced, Not ForgottenHood ornaments didn’t disappear because drivers suddenly stopped liking them.
